Ingredients
Scale
- 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1 cup baby spinach
- 1 cup orzo pasta
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 1/2 cup heavy cream
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- Fresh basil, for garnish
Instructions
- Season the chicken breasts with sal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ning, rubbing the spices in well.
-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the seasoned chicken breasts and cook for 6-7 minutes on each side until golden brown and cooked through. Check for doneness by cutting into the thickest part; it should be no longer pink inside.
- Remove the chicken from the skillet and set aside on a plate, covering it with foil to keep warm.
- In the same skillet, add minced garlic and s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ant, being careful not to burn it.
- Add cherry tomatoes and cook for 3-4 minutes, stirring occasionally, until they soften and release their juices.
- Stir in the orzo pasta and toast slightly for 1-2 minutes to enhance its flavor.
- Pour in the chicken broth, bring to a boil, then reduce heat to a simmer and cover. Cook for 10-12 minutes, or until the orzo is tender and has absorbed most of the liquid, stirring occasionally.
- While the orzo cooks, chop the cooked chicken into bite-sized pieces.
- Once the orzo is cooked, stir in the baby spinach until wilted.
- Pour in the heavy cream and stir until well combined for a rich texture.
- Add the chopped chicken and grated Parmesan cheese, stirring until the cheese melts and the chicken is heated through. Adjust seasoning with more salt and pepper if needed.
- Remove the skillet from heat and spoon the Tuscan chicken orzo into bowls.
- Garnish with fresh basil leaves and extra Parmesan if desired.

Notes
-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in a skillet over medium heat, adding a splash of chicken broth or cream if too thick.
- This dish can be frozen for up to 2 months. Cool completely before transferring to a freezer-safe container. Thaw in the refrigerator overnight before reheating.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
